Konfigurieren Sie einen S3-kompatiblen Objektspeicheranbieter für Uploads

Hallo zusammen – ich wollte nur Bescheid geben, dass der Objektspeicher von Hetzner ziemlich gut zu funktionieren scheint. Dies sind die Einstellungen, die ich zu meiner app.yaml hinzugefügt habe:

DISCOURSE_USE_S3: true
DISCOURSE_S3_REGION: whatever
DISCOURSE_S3_INSTALL_CORS_RULE: false
DISCOURSE_S3_ENDPOINT: https://nbg1.your-objectstorage.com
DISCOURSE_S3_ACCESS_KEY_ID: xxxx
DISCOURSE_S3_SECRET_ACCESS_KEY: xxxx
DISCOURSE_S3_CDN_URL: xxxx
DISCOURSE_S3_BUCKET: discourseuploads
DISCOURSE_S3_BACKUP_BUCKET: discoursebackups
DISCOURSE_BACKUP_LOCATION: s3

Ersetzen Sie natürlich die folgenden Werte durch Ihre eigenen Einstellungen:

DISCOURSE_S3_ENDPOINT: (verwenden Sie die URL aus dem Hetzner-Dashboard für den Standort, an dem Sie Ihren Objektspeicher-Bucket erstellt haben)
DIS কর্তা_S3_ACCESS_KEY_ID: (selbsterklärend)
DISCOURSE_S3_SECRET_ACCESS_KEY: (selbsterklärend)
DISCOURSE_S3_CDN_URL: (verwenden Sie hier die CDN-URL, die von der URL Ihres Hetzner-Buckets zieht)

Ich werde es in den nächsten Wochen/Monaten auf meinem Testserver im Auge behalten, aber bisher sieht es gut aus.

2 „Gefällt mir“